Supercharge Your Circulation: Heart-Healthy Eating Guide

Fuel your body with the right nutrients to improve blood flow and support a healthy heart. A diet rich in fruits, vegetables and whole grains can make a world of difference. Limit processed foods, unhealthy fats, and added sugars to minimize your risk of heart disease. Stay hydrated by drinking plenty of water throughout the day. Incorporate regular movement into your routine to improve circulation even further.

  • Choose lean protein sources like fish, poultry, and beans.
  • Embrace healthy fats from avocados, nuts, and olive oil.
  • Control your intake of sodium to support healthy blood pressure.

Note that making gradual adjustments to your diet can have a lasting impact on your heart health. Consult with a healthcare professional or registered dietitian for personalized guidance.
